# youhunwl/tvapp

**Attribution required: if you use, quote, or summarise this content, you must credit and link back to [awesome-repositories.com](https://awesome-repositories.com/repository/youhunwl-tvapp).**

18,382 stars · 2,455 forks · JavaScript · Apache-2.0

## Links

- GitHub: https://github.com/youhunwl/TVAPP
- Homepage: https://app.iyouhun.com
- awesome-repositories: https://awesome-repositories.com/repository/youhunwl-tvapp.md

## Topics

`android` `android-tv` `apk` `app` `tv` `tv-box`

## Description

TVAPP is an IPTV stream aggregator and media content indexer designed to collect and organize daily updated streaming links into a single interface. It functions as a central platform for discovering and accessing free media content by aggregating links from multiple online sources.

The application distinguishes itself through its ability to manage M3U playlists and provide live stream management, ensuring that broadcast links remain accessible across different platforms. By utilizing static-asset configuration mapping and remote-source data aggregation, the tool maintains a unified local index that simplifies the process of finding and playing television and video content.

The system includes capabilities for cross-platform media abstraction and client-side stream resolution, which normalize diverse formats for consistent playback. The interface is maintained through declarative state binding, which automatically updates the visual display based on the aggregated media list and user selections.

## Tags

### Content Management & Publishing

- [Media Aggregators](https://awesome-repositories.com/f/content-management-publishing/content-aggregation-curation/content-aggregators/media-aggregators.md) — Aggregates daily updated streaming links from multiple sources into a central location for free media discovery. ([source](https://app.iyouhun.com))
- [IPTV & Live TV](https://awesome-repositories.com/f/content-management-publishing/media-management/iptv-live-tv.md) — Manages and maintains daily updated live broadcast links to ensure reliable television playback.
- [Media Curation Tools](https://awesome-repositories.com/f/content-management-publishing/media-management/media-curation-tools.md) — Provides a curated collection of streaming links to simplify discovering and accessing television content.

### Graphics & Multimedia

- [Playlist Aggregators](https://awesome-repositories.com/f/graphics-multimedia/streaming-distribution/streaming-broadcasting/media-streaming/playlist-aggregators.md) — Provides utilities for managing and maintaining M3U playlist collections to simplify live television and video playback.

### Networking & Communication

- [Stream Aggregators](https://awesome-repositories.com/f/networking-communication/stream-aggregators.md) — Acts as a central platform for collecting and organizing daily updated media stream links for unified playback.

### Software Engineering & Architecture

- [Cross-Platform Abstraction Layers](https://awesome-repositories.com/f/software-engineering-architecture/cross-platform-abstraction-layers.md) — Normalizes diverse stream formats and protocols into a consistent internal representation for cross-platform playback.

### Web Development

- [Client-Side Media Processing](https://awesome-repositories.com/f/web-development/client-side-media-processing.md) — Extracts playable media URLs from remote sources directly within the application runtime for seamless playback.
